Book Review: Suspense, mystery, fantasy prevail! Summary: 5 Stars
A little slow to start, but by the 2nd or 3rd chapter, this book captures your attention and makes you want to keep reading. It is filled with suspense, mystery, humor, and fantasy. After I read it, I had my 13-year-old daughter (who does NOT like to read) read it. She didn't enjoy it nearly as much as my 11-year-old son, but she did have to agree it was entertaining. Small print, long book. Best for accomplished independent readers. It would also make a great read aloud.
